Danns pulls out of Palace contract talks

Neil Danns has rejected a new contract offer from Crystal Palace.

The Daily Mail says Danns has put a host of Championship clubs on alert after rejecting Crystal Palace’s latest contract offer.

The 27-year-old former Blackburn Rovers midfielder is in the last year of his present contract at Selhurst Park and the Palace board had been hopeful that he would sign a new three-year deal.

Leicester are watching developments and should Danns fail to reach a compromise with Palace, he will be able to sign a pre-contract agreement with any club from January 1.
